In FM-based design, what is the purpose of identifying uplift attachment?

Explanation:
In FM-based design, uplifting attachment is all about how the roof system is fastened to withstand wind pulling upward on it. By identifying the uplift attachment, you determine the required attachment strength and pattern—what fasteners, adhesives, and edge/center attachments are needed—so the membrane and roof assembly stay secured under design wind pressures. This is crucial for preventing roof movement or failure during high winds. It isn’t about lighting loads, membrane color, or HVAC choices, which are unrelated to wind uplift resistance.
